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8872686 870649 40014
875331 567142499 28137613210
875331 567142499 28137613210
303316043 152 89024876 0892
All about undefined
Interested in learning more?
875331 567142499 28137613210
303316043 152 89024876 0892
See more
2673 07279122747
049109831 58944 66
See more
315017 5386 5013159808
41107640 5024596822 0428487486 413
See more